Chelsea have offered £10m for Benfica's Brazil defender David Luiz. Manchester City and Real Madrid are also interested in the 23-year-old. Full story: The Times
Barcelona are determined to sign Fernando Torres from Liverpool but say they will not pay more than £38m for the Spain striker. Full story: Daily Mail
Newcastle have made a surprise move to sign Bolton left-back Jlloyd Samuel as they look to strengthen their side for the Premier League next season. Full story: Daily Mirror
Meanwhile, Magpies manager Chris Hughton is set to make a £1m bid for Algeria goalkeeper Rais M'bolhi. Full story: The Sun
Manchester City's Brazil striker Robinho, whose loan agreement with Santos expires in August, will be told on Wednesday he can leave the Eastlands club. Full story: Daily Mirror
Birmingham manager Alex McLeish has ruled himself out of the running to sign Rangers striker Kris Boyd and Celtic winger Aiden McGeady. Full story: Daily Record
South Africa striker Katlego Mphela is wanted by McLeish's Blues. Full story: The Sun
Birmingham and Fulham are both interested in Twente's Ivory Coast midfielder Cheik Ismael Tiote. Full story: The Sun
Serbia striker Milan Jovanovic has hinted that he might pull out of his move to Liverpool and follow former Reds boss Rafael Benitez to Inter Milan. Jovanovic, whose contract with Standard Liege ended this summer, signed a pre-contract deal with the Anfield club in February. Full story: Tuttomercatoweb.com
Tottenham winger Giovani dos Santos is a target for Italian side Genoa. Full story: The Sun
Everton are eyeing up a £5m deal for Italy Under-21 defender Angelo Ogbonna, who plays for Torino. Full story: Daily Mail
Blackpool are set to pull out of a permanent move for striker Stephen Dobbie, who has been on loan from Swansea, as they are not happy with the £500,000 asking price. Full story: The Sun

Fulham will turn to former Manchester City manager Sven-Goran Eriksson if boss Roy Hodgson leaves for Liverpool or England. (Daily Express)
Liverpool managing director Christian Purslow says no players will be allowed to leave Anfield until a new manager is appointed and gives the go-ahead. Full story: Daily Mirror
Former Celtic boss Tony Mowbray and ex-Wales midfielder Gary Speed are in line for the vacant manager's job at Hull. The Championship club have cooled their interest in former Portsmouth manager Paul Hart. Full story: Daily Mirror

Blackburn's players are set for a relatively short summer holiday as manager Sam Allardyce is starting pre-season training on 28 June. Allardyce feels that his team were short on fitness last season. Full story: Daily Mirror
